I NEVER could figure out Just
* what was wrong w ith m y
bedroom ." said a woman to me the
o ilie r day, “ u ntil 1 took it apart
piece by piece. Then it suddenly
dawned on me that the floral p rin t
bedspread was m aking the room
look crowded und obscuring e ve ry­
thing else.”
Rounded Shoulders
When the bedspread In this p a r­
tic u la r room was changed to a con­
servative solid colored weave In a
plain pattern minus flounces, the
room took on an e n tire ly new and
rea lly pleasing uppearance.
Just as In all rooms in the home,
decoration of the bedroom m ust be
ca refully planned, keeping In m ind
the size, exposures, lig h t and other
furnishings.
F irs t of all, le t’s set down some
basic principles. I f the room is
rath er dark — those w ith north and
east exposures p a rtic u la rly — you
must use ligh t colors in It. I t the
room is cold in addition to being
dark, w arm it w ith yellows, reds
and orange. I f the room is w arm in
feeling, you m ay want to cool It
w ith tones of blue and green or
I maroon.
